About Wentao Fu
Wentao Fu is a scholar working on Industrial and Manufacturing Engineering, Media Technology, Aerospace Engineering, Mechanical Engineering and Atmospheric Science, having authored 43 papers that have together received 359 indexed citations. Recurring topics across this work include Manufacturing Process and Optimization (8 papers), Remote Sensing and Land Use (6 papers), Remote-Sensing Image Classification (6 papers), GNSS positioning and interference (5 papers), Remote Sensing in Agriculture (4 papers), Additive Manufacturing and 3D Printing Technologies (4 papers), Ionosphere and magnetosphere dynamics (3 papers) and Engineering Technology and Methodologies (3 papers). The work is most often cited by research in Rehabilitation (43 citations), Industrial and Manufacturing Engineering (50 citations), Automotive Engineering (44 citations), Media Technology (27 citations) and Biomaterials (36 citations). Wentao Fu has collaborated with scholars based in China, United States and Germany. Frequent co-authors include Xiyan Sun, Matthew I. Campbell, Zhongtao Zhang, Zhengyang Yang, Yuanfa Ji, Hongwei Yao, Yiqiao Hu, Yuhao Cheng, Jingxin Ma and Henghui Huang. Their work appears in journals such as IEEE Access, Journal of Mechanical Design, The International Journal of Advanced Manufacturing Technology, Journal of Adhesion Science and Technology and IEEE Internet of Things Journal.
